METHOD:
In a saucepan, melt the sugar, then add cream and stir well until a smooth caramel is formed.
Add a pinch of freshly ground salt.
Set aside.
In a saucepan, melt butter and chocolate over low heat.
Remove from heat and add cocoa, then eggs, one at a time, mixing well after each.
Add the sugar, vanilla, flour and walnuts.
Mix well and place half the mixture in a cake pan greased with butter.
Add spoonfuls of caramel, cover with the remaining batter and bake in preheated oven at 350°F for approximately 30 minutes.
Serve with ice cream.
